    I personally live, work and die by bartPE.

    My pe disc contains everything i need to get a (l)users machine up in a minimal amount of time. I use mcafee's command line scanner and bug zapper for viruses, adaware to kill *ware, ghost if I need it, stuff like that. I typically build a new disc every weekend, or when something new rears it's ugly head.

    Then I have my Uber favorite PE disk. It contains all files and executables necessary for data recovery, including cd burning tools.

    All this with a nifty windows GUI with full NTFS read-write support.
